Before Wednesday’s night game, Dallas Cowboys wide receiver Kevin Ogletree never scored a touchdown during a three-year NFL career.
With just a scant 25 catches to his credit, Ogletree riddled New York’s secondary for 114 yards on eight receptions and a pair of touchdowns during an opening night 24-17 Cowboys victory.
Since Jason Witten was running around with a proverbial piano on his back due to a lacerated spleen, the Cowboys desperately needed another contributor.
Enter Ogletree, who will fill the role of the departed Laurent Robinson.
For once, it’s time to give Ogletree’s much-maligned quarterback some credit. When he needed to deliver, Tony Romo did just that.
